Ok i got my xbox 360 to work with my 22inch monitor but my ainol v8000hds wont work, i tried a hd to dvi adapter and that didnt work and now iv tried an av to vga adapter also didnt work, any ideas?

the dvi adapter i used here

http://cgi.ebay.co.uk/DVI-Male-HDMI-Fem ... 45f5757ebb

the av to vga adapter i used here.

http://cgi.ebay.co.uk/VGA-S-VIDEO-3RCA- ... 27b7ea7c65

i got the sound to output fine to my set of speakers but the video just wont work.

Well eraldo20 said that the xbox 360 did work when connected with the hdmi to dvi adapter to monitor so it shows that the dvi on monitor is hdcp compatible at least.

My old ViewSonic VX2025wm is not hdcp compatible as I tried to hook up my PS3 to it with a hdmi to dvi cable that I know works.

I'm not shocked that the VGA to component converter didn't work, but I am surprised at the problem you had converting HDMI to DVI. From what I understand, the physical shape is different, but the video information traveling over those two difference cable types is identical. Of course by converting to DVI, you lose sound, but the video content is the same.

I hope mentioning a another company which is not a direct competitor to MP4nation is kosher. If not, I apologize in advance. There's a company called Monoprice which is THE place to go for high-quality, yet shockingly affordable computer, audio and video cables and adapters. I have no relationship with them except as a satisfied customer (just as I am with MP4nation). They have a variety of adapters and cables which could help and are nearly guaranteed to be higher in quality than the ebay stuff you bought.

I just got a 5000HDG and successfully connected it to a HD monitor/TV through the HDMI cable which came with it (an extra accessory). In order to make it work, i had to go into settings on the device and select which type/resolution. On my device, I did this with buttons on the top, but on some devices you may need to have a remote control to access the settings. I'm probably not telling you anything you don't know, but it doesn't hurt to cover all your bases. In my case I think I selected HDMI 720p/60Hz, though 50 also worked.

I hope you can get it to work with your monitor. It's a nice benefit that I didn't have on my last PMP.
